Title: Pricing help?
Post by: gaz1984mcc on October 18, 2011, 04:31:50 pm
Hi everyone i would like to know if anyone could give me some sort of an idea for pricing on a two seater settee and an single recliner chair. Whats the going rate for this kind of work i really want to land this job but i dont want to be too cheap. Im hoping this could lead to other work as this is for a care company's reception area near to me.

Thanks

Title: Re: Pricing help?
Post by: Bbarrow on October 18, 2011, 04:43:09 pm
anything between £60-£160, depends how much you want to earn, wat ur over heads are and if it is going to lead to other work.ppls pricing differs alot on here. if i was you i wouldnt go to high if you truely think you may get other work from it, but make sure you dont do it cheap as you need to make money and you will be setting ur self up for a fall if you do get more work from it. (they will expect that cheap as well)
